How long to settle in with new skincare stuff?

I usually use Clinique 3-step but fancy something cheaper a change.

I bought some Body Shop Aloe (sensitive skin) day and night creams plus the eye cream today. I'm had in on my skin for a couple of hours and it's not stinging, so I don't think I'm going to react badly to it (am prone to doing so - can't use Simple, No7 etc.).

The saleswoman in the Body Shop said that I should give it a month before deciding if it really suits my skin or not, as that's how long it takes for skin to renew itself.

Is that right - as long as your face didn't actually burn off, would you give a new moisturiser a month before deciding if it's for you or not?

She did say that I could bring it back for an exchange if it wasn't right for me, so I don't think she was just trying to get me to use it up!
